Definition
Legal professionals conduct research on legal problems, advise clients on legal aspects of problems, plead cases or conduct prosecutions in courts of law, preside over judicial proceedings in courts of law and draft laws and regulations
Tasks include
Tasks performed usually include: giving clients legal advice, undertaking legal business on clients behalf, and conducting litigation when necessary; presiding over judicial proceedings- and pronouncing judgement in courts of law. Supervision of other workers may be included.
Included occupations or child groups
Occupations in this minor group are classified into the following unit groups: 2611 Lawyers 2612 Judges 2619 Legal professionals not elsewhere classified
